UK: Piccadilly Gardens in Manchester cordoned off after cops find suspicious package

London, May 3 (Sputnik): UK police cordoned off on Friday Piccadilly Gardens, a green space in Manchester city center, after finding a suspicious package nearby, the Greater Manchester Police said.

"A cordon is in place in Piccadilly Gardens after reports of a suspicious package were made. A man aged 26 has been detained by police and enquiries into the incident are ongoing," the police said on its Twitter blog.

The police also called on the people working nearby to follow the directions from the police and stay indoors if asked to do so.
